Hello community,
here is the log from the commit of package wireshark
checked in at Tue Aug 29 18:03:31 CEST 2006.
--------
--- wireshark/wireshark.changes 2006-07-26 02:01:26.000000000 +0200
+++ wireshark/wireshark.changes 2006-08-29 16:45:46.000000000 +0200
@@ -1,0 +2,11 @@
+Thu Aug 24 13:31:08 CEST 2006 - postadal@suse.cz
+
+- updated to version 0.99.2 [#201437]
+ * security bugfixes
+ * the packet list context menu now includes a conversation filter
+ * now generate ACL rules for several popular firewall products
+ * new protocols: Daytime, JPEG (RTP payload), Pegasus Lightweight
+ Stream Control, Pro-MPEG FEC, UMTS RRC, Veritas Low Latency Transport
+- removed oblsoleted patch buffer_overflow_fix.patch
+
+-------------------------------------------------------------------
Old:
----
wireshark-0.99.2-buffer_overflow_fix.patch
wireshark-0.99.2-config.diff
wireshark-0.99.2.tar.bz2
New:
----
missing_files.tar.bz2
wireshark-0.99.3-config.diff
wireshark-0.99.3-gcc.patch
wireshark-0.99.3.tar.bz2
++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Other differences:
------------------
++++++ wireshark.spec ++++++
--- /var/tmp/diff_new_pack.87WIAW/_old 2006-08-29 18:03:11.000000000 +0200
+++ /var/tmp/diff_new_pack.87WIAW/_new 2006-08-29 18:03:11.000000000 +0200
@@ -1,5 +1,5 @@
#
-# spec file for package wireshark (Version 0.99.2)
+# spec file for package wireshark (Version 0.99.3)
#
# Copyright (c) 2006 SUSE LINUX Products GmbH, Nuernberg, Germany.
# This file and all modifications and additions to the pristine
@@ -16,21 +16,22 @@
Group: Productivity/Networking/Diagnostic
Autoreqprov: on
Summary: A Network Traffic Analyser
-Version: 0.99.2
+Version: 0.99.3
Release: 1
-URL: http://ethereal.com/
+URL: http://www.wireshark.org/
Source: http://www.wireshark.org/download/src/%{name}-%{version}.tar.bz2
Source1: %{name}.desktop
Source2: %{name}.png
Source3: include.filelist
+Source4: missing_files.tar.bz2
Patch4: %{name}-%{version}-config.diff
-Patch5: %{name}-%{version}-buffer_overflow_fix.patch
+Patch5: %{name}-%{version}-gcc.patch
BuildRoot: %{_tmppath}/%{name}-%{version}-build
Provides: ethereal
Obsoletes: ethereal
%description
-Ethereal is a free network protocol analyzer for Unix and Windows. It
+Wireshark is a free network protocol analyzer for Unix and Windows. It
allows you to examine data from a live network or from a capture file
on disk. You can interactively browse the capture data, viewing summary
and detail information for each packet. Ethereal has several powerful
@@ -74,7 +75,7 @@
Obsoletes: ethereal-devel
%description devel
-Ethereal is a free network protocol analyzer for Unix and Windows. It
+Wireshark is a free network protocol analyzer for Unix and Windows. It
allows you to examine data from a live network or from a capture file
on disk. You can interactively browse the capture data, viewing summary
and detail information for each packet. Ethereal has several powerful
@@ -110,7 +111,7 @@
and many others. For details see /usr/share/doc/packages/ethereal/AUTHORS
%prep
-%setup -q
+%setup -q -a 4
%patch4
%patch5
@@ -178,6 +179,14 @@
%{_mandir}/man1/idl2wrs*
%changelog -n wireshark
+* Thu Aug 24 2006 - postadal@suse.cz
+- updated to version 0.99.2 [#201437]
+ * security bugfixes
+ * the packet list context menu now includes a conversation filter
+ * now generate ACL rules for several popular firewall products
+ * new protocols: Daytime, JPEG (RTP payload), Pegasus Lightweight
+ Stream Control, Pro-MPEG FEC, UMTS RRC, Veritas Low Latency Transport
+- removed oblsoleted patch buffer_overflow_fix.patch
* Tue Jul 25 2006 - postadal@suse.cz
- project Ethereal moved to Wireshark project (renamed)
- updated to version 0.99.2
++++++ wireshark-0.99.2-config.diff -> wireshark-0.99.3-config.diff ++++++
++++++ wireshark-0.99.3-gcc.patch ++++++
--- epan/dissectors/packet-bootp.c
+++ epan/dissectors/packet-bootp.c
@@ -1216,7 +1216,7 @@
if (code == pkt_ccc_option) {
skip_opaque = TRUE;
proto_item_append_text(vti,
- "CableLabs Client Configuration (%d bytes)");
+ "CableLabs Client Configuration (%d bytes)", optlen);
optend = optoff + optlen;
while (optoff < optend) {
switch (pkt_ccc_protocol_version) {
--- epan/dissectors/packet-dcom.c
+++ epan/dissectors/packet-dcom.c
@@ -250,7 +250,7 @@
for(objects = machine->objects; objects != NULL; objects = g_list_next(objects)) {
object = objects->data;
- g_warning(" Object(#%4u): OID:0x%x%x private:0x%x", object->first_packet, object->oid, object->private_data);
+ g_warning(" Object(#%4u): OID:0x%" PRIx64 " private:%p", object->first_packet, object->oid, object->private_data);
for(interfaces = object->interfaces; interfaces != NULL; interfaces = g_list_next(interfaces)) {
interf = interfaces->data;
--- epan/dissectors/packet-dcom-cba-acco.c
+++ epan/dissectors/packet-dcom-cba-acco.c
@@ -30,6 +30,7 @@
#include